Is a mini stepper worth bothering with?

I need to up my exercise levels. I do no structured exercise, 13k steps a day. Oncea week I go for a walk or bike ride for 1 hour ish.

I have some weights so will start using those, but no real motivation for gone exercise routines, and as a single working parent no way to go to gym or classes due to children.

I could use a stepper when they're in bed.
Or...any other suggestions?

I love my mini stepper….
it’s a recent purchase and I did a lot of research and read reviews and watched utube videos before buying it .
it’s sturdy and takes up little space , easily fits behind a chair or under a sofa
very versatile piece of equipment and can be used multiple ways , with weights , kettle bells , exercise bands etc
i started off at 15 minutes and will gradually increase the time and introduce weights . I definitely feel better , it encourages good posture ( your back will hurt if you slouch !) and if you loathe running and / or rowing it can be a great cardio workout, it also improves balance
I have previously done exercise so am not a complete novice however recently I’ve become rather lazy , though I do walk and at work I’m on my feet all the time
